Depredation permits are not available this year because of a pending lawsuit against WDFW by CBD. In recent years the new landowners in there have been doing depredation hunts. I don't believe Hancock has been.
As far as finding damage... The 'red flags' are really starting to show. Look for a stand of 12-18 year old reprod with red/yellow trees showing. That was last years damage, and new damage will be showing up shortly in the same stand if not already there. The problem is finding them in there. When fawns drop, try calling, otherwise pretty slim odds.
